PyRank
  • Insights
  • PyPI
  • GitHub
  • Search
  • Compare
  • Advisories
  • Ecosystem
  • About

Design By Contract Python Packages

Python packages with the GitHub topic design-by-contract. Sorted by relevance, with stars and monthly downloads.
life4
deal

🤝 Design by contract for Python. Write bug-free code. Add a few decorators, get static analysis and tests for free.

63K 891 36
AlexandreDecan
sismic

Sismic Interactive Statechart Model Interpreter and Checker http://sismic.readthedocs.io/

9K 161 30
tefx
invar-tools

From AI-generated to AI-engineered code. Guides AI agents to write verifiable code through contracts and structured workflows.

2K 2 1
Tefx
python-invar

From AI-generated to AI-engineered code. Guides AI agents to write verifiable code through contracts and structured workflows.

455 2 1
orsinium
djburger

Framework for safe and maintainable web-projects.

451 75 6
helgster77
serenecode

Verification framework for AI-generated Python — test coverage, property testing, and symbolic execution

411 10 0
tungminhphan
traffic-intersection

This is an example of the design-by-contract method

349 14 6
StefanUlbrich
design-by-contract

Handy decorator to define contracts with dependency injection in Python 3.10 and above

255 102 7
tefx
invar-runtime

From AI-generated to AI-engineered code. Guides AI agents to write verifiable code through contracts and structured workflows.

227 2 1
abeltavares
pysertive

✔️ Assertive python design by contract toolkit for software validation. Simplify preconditions, postconditions, and invariants with easy-to-use decorators.

74 6 1
    • Data from PyPI, GitHub, ClickHouse, and BigQuery